The Licensing Refine Explained

Understanding exactly how professionals acquire their licenses can shed light on their relevance. Here's a review:

Education Requirements: Several states need contractors to have official education and learning or training prior to seeking a license. Examinations: After finishing instructional demands, prospects must pass an examination covering relevant laws and practices. Background Checks: To make sure stability, several licensing boards carry out criminal background examine applicants. Insurance Proof: An accredited professional typically brings liability insurance coverage to secure clients versus potential damages. State-Specific Licensing Regulations

Common Misconceptions About Specialist Licenses Misconception 1: All service providers require licenses. Reality: Not all types of work require licensing; it depends upon regional regulations. Misconception 2: Certified contractors are constantly far better than unlicensed ones. Reality: While licensing indicates particular qualifications, experience also plays a crucial role. Misconception 3: Once certified, specialists never require to restore or update their skills. Reality: Many states call for periodic revival or continuing education. Frequently Asked Inquiries (Frequently asked questions) FAQ 1: Why do I require an accredited service provider for my home renovations?

Licensed service providers ensure adherence to security codes, give guarantees on their work, and offer comfort recognizing you're secured by customer laws.

FAQ 2: What occurs if I work with an unlicensed contractor?

You may encounter legal issues if something fails throughout the job because you will not have choice via customer securities offered when working with licensed professionals.

FAQ 3: Can I examine if my contractor is accredited online?

Yes! Many states keep data sources where you can verify your professional's licensing status easily online.

FAQ 4: Is it a lot more expensive to employ licensed contractors?

While they frequently bill higher rates initially because of their credentials and experience, employing certified professionals might save you cash long term by staying clear of pricey mistakes and repair work later on on.

FAQ 5: Do all sorts of specialists require licenses?

No! It varies by type (general vs specialized) and location; nevertheless, numerous household work types do require some kind of licensing.

FAQ 6: How typically do licenses require renewing?

Typically every one-to-three years depending on the state's guidelines; many territories likewise require evidence of proceeding education during revival cycles.
